Summary: | System settings crash in handleContextCreationFailure | ||
---|---|---|---|
Product: | [Applications] systemsettings | Reporter: | Marcio Merlone <mmerlone> |
Component: | general | Assignee: | Plasma Bugs List <plasma-bugs> |
Status: | RESOLVED NOT A BUG | ||
Severity: | crash | CC: | calvinjabel, flrieverb, gregorystarr00, jrmclaugh, kde, pajonk, popguz, rushil.perera1081 |
Priority: | NOR | Keywords: | drkonqi |
Version: | 5.19.2 | ||
Target Milestone: | --- | ||
Platform: | Neon | ||
OS: | Linux | ||
Latest Commit: | Version Fixed In: | ||
Attachments: |
New crash information added by DrKonqi
New crash information added by DrKonqi |
Description
Marcio Merlone
2020-06-25 12:28:13 UTC
and plasmashell (the panel) is still working correctly? (In reply to David Edmundson from comment #1) > and plasmashell (the panel) is still working correctly? Yes. No other visible error. Did not rebooted yet to try again, so if you need more info I can try again. ok, just to confirm that this bug is what I think it is: if you go to a terminal and type "plasmashell --replace" plasma will restart, but with a warning icon in the system tray about degraded graphics stack then system settings will start working again (rebooting will also fix it, but I'd like to go through this to test a path please) (In reply to David Edmundson from comment #3) > ok, just to confirm that this bug is what I think it is: > > if you go to a terminal and type "plasmashell --replace" > plasma will restart, but with a warning icon in the system tray about > degraded graphics stack > > then system settings will start working again > > > (rebooting will also fix it, but I'd like to go through this to test a path > please) Works, System settings opened after replace. Tryied to paste recent apt/history.log (systemsettings-dbgsym:amd64 and some nvidia packages among others) but bugzilla blocked as spam. The output if worth something (too big to fit here): https://pastebin.com/Gcc7W6zH it'll be the nvidia driver; it upgrades the libGL and the kernel all at once If you open a new client you get new libGL with old kernel and it fails. I put in a hook to catch it in plasmashell and then enable fallback rendering for everyone after that. I'm starting to think I need to put the hook in everywhere. *** Bug 423738 has been marked as a duplicate of this bug. *** *** Bug 420989 has been marked as a duplicate of this bug. *** *** Bug 423634 has been marked as a duplicate of this bug. *** *** Bug 423503 has been marked as a duplicate of this bug. *** Created attachment 129849 [details]
New crash information added by DrKonqi
systemsettings5 (5.18.4) using Qt 5.12.8
- What I was doing when the application crashed:
Just tried to open the settings app and it crashed imeditely, continued to crash on each reload.
Also noticed that discord notification bubble was displaying 0 instead of disapearing.
Both issues fixed by running plasmashell --replace in the terminal.
-- Backtrace (Reduced):
#6 __GI_raise (sig=sig@entry=6) at ../sysdeps/unix/sysv/linux/raise.c:50
#7 0x00007fbd4f53f859 in __GI_abort () at abort.c:79
#8 0x00007fbd4f972aad in QMessageLogger::fatal(char const*, ...) const () from /lib/x86_64-linux-gnu/libQt5Core.so.5
[...]
#11 0x00007fbd4f30f036 in QQuickWidget::resizeEvent(QResizeEvent*) () from /lib/x86_64-linux-gnu/libQt5QuickWidgets.so.5
#12 0x00007fbd5066c947 in QWidget::event(QEvent*) () from /lib/x86_64-linux-gnu/libQt5Widgets.so.5
Created attachment 131841 [details]
New crash information added by DrKonqi
systemsettings5 (5.18.4) using Qt 5.12.8
- What I was doing when the application crashed:
Browing internet nothing much more to say. Had only 5 cards open at the time so i dont think it was a problem.
-- Backtrace (Reduced):
#6 __GI_raise (sig=sig@entry=6) at ../sysdeps/unix/sysv/linux/raise.c:50
#7 0x00007faf4ec81859 in __GI_abort () at abort.c:79
#8 0x00007faf4f0b4aad in QMessageLogger::fatal(char const*, ...) const () from /lib/x86_64-linux-gnu/libQt5Core.so.5
[...]
#11 0x00007faf4ea51036 in QQuickWidget::resizeEvent(QResizeEvent*) () from /lib/x86_64-linux-gnu/libQt5QuickWidgets.so.5
#12 0x00007faf4fdae947 in QWidget::event(QEvent*) () from /lib/x86_64-linux-gnu/libQt5Widgets.so.5
*** Bug 426830 has been marked as a duplicate of this bug. *** |